UPDATE: A severe weather alert has been issued for parts of Pennsylvania as dense fog is expected to persist until 12:30 a.m. on October 27, 2023. The National Weather Service confirmed this alert at 8:27 p.m. on Thursday, warning residents in Elk, Clearfield, Cambria, and Somerset counties to exercise extreme caution.

Visibility has plummeted to under a quarter of a mile in some areas, creating hazardous driving conditions. The weather service noted that “clouds are touching the tops of the ridges this evening,” contributing to the rapid fog formation. Immediate action is necessary for anyone traveling over higher terrains, as sudden changes in visibility may occur.

Officials emphasize that the fog will not clear overnight and is expected to gradually improve only by Friday morning. Motorists are strongly advised to adhere to essential safety precautions to navigate these dangerous conditions:

– **Moderate your speed** to adapt to changing visibility.
– **Prioritize visibility** by using low-beam headlights.
– **Avoid high-beams**, which can worsen visibility in fog.
– **Maintain safe gaps** between vehicles to allow for sudden stops.
– **Stay in your lane** while driving to prevent accidents.
– **Prepare for zero visibility** scenarios, which may arise suddenly.
– **Be aware of limited parking options** due to thick fog.

With the potential for reduced visibility and increased accident risk, following these guidelines is crucial to ensure personal safety on the roads.
